HB 1626 Tennessee House · 114th Regular Session (2025-2026)

Bail, Bail Bonds - As introduced, requires bondsmen to file the quarterly reports on number of bonds issued by the bondsman in the preceding quarter by the thirtieth day of January, April, July, and October, rather than the twenty-fifth day; requires court clerks to file the quarterly reports on number of bonds accepted by the clerk in the preceding quarter by the thirtieth day of January, April, July, and October, rather than the twenty-fifth day. - Amends TCA Title 40, Chapter 11.

HB 1626 changes the quarterly reporting deadlines for bail bondsmen and court clerks in Tennessee. Specifically, it extends the filing dates for reports on bonds issued (by bondsmen) and bonds accepted (by court clerks) from the 25th to the 30th of January, April, July, and October each year. This procedural adjustment affects all licensed bail bondsmen and court clerks statewide who submit these quarterly reports under Tennessee law. The bill does not alter the content or requirements of the reports, only the submission deadlines.
